When choosing food storage containers, there are several safety considerations to keep in mind. Here are some tips to ensure food safety:

  1. Material: Choose containers made of non-toxic materials such as glass, stainless steel, or ceramic.
  2. Airtight: Ensure that the container has an airtight seal to prevent bacteria and air from getting in.
  3. No cracks or chips: Inspect the container for cracks and chips before purchasing. Cracks and chips can harbor bacteria and compromise the integrity of the container.
  4. BPA-free: If you are purchasing plastic containers, ensure that they are BPA-free. BPA is a harmful chemical that can leach into food and cause health problems.
  5. Easy to clean: Choose containers that are easy to clean and sanitize to prevent the buildup of bacteria.

No matter which type of container you choose, it's important to care for it properly to ensure it lasts as long as possible. Here are some tips:

  • Always follow the manufacturer's instructions for use and cleaning
  • Avoid exposing containers to extreme temperatures, as this can cause warping or cracking
  • Use a non-abrasive sponge or cloth when cleaning to avoid scratches
  • Store containers in a cool, dry place to prevent any moisture buildup
  • Replace any containers that are cracked, warped, or have missing lids to ensure they're still safe for use

Caring for ceramic containers is crucial to ensure their longevity and food safety. Here are some tips on how to care for them:

  1. Avoid extreme temperatures: Do not expose ceramic containers to extreme temperatures, such as placing them in the freezer immediately after removing them from the oven. This can cause cracking and compromise the integrity of the container.
  2. Store carefully: Store ceramic containers carefully to prevent chipping and breaking. Stack them with care and avoid stacking them too high.
  3. Check for cracks and chips: Regularly inspect ceramic containers for cracks and chips. If you notice any, discard them immediately.
